    What are hot numbers and why do they matter for the casual player

    Hot numbers are those that appear more often than the average over a given period. In roulette, the wheel is designed to be random so long term bias is unlikely. Still you can observe short term streaks or clusters and use them as a guide for bets. The casual player should view hot numbers as possible opportunities not guarantees. Use them to inform bets rather than to chase losses.

    Q A does table history matter in live play
    A Some players find it helpful but remember each spin is independent so history is only a guide not a guarantee
